7 ways students can retain more in less time: The case for ending cramming sessions

In 2025, cramming is losing relevance as research highlights smarter learning methods for lasting retention. Techniques like spaced repetition, microlearning, active recall, and interleaving outperform last-minute study. Consistent habits, optimized environments, sleep, and nutrition further boost memory. By replacing cramming with evidence-based strategies, students can learn faster, retain more, and achieve long-term academic success.

Haryana fraudsters arrested in Bhubaneswar for posing as officials of fake commission

Bhubaneswar police arrested two Haryana fraudsters, Choudhury Rinku Saini and Maninder Singh, for impersonating officials of a fictitious ‘Social Justice and Women Empowerment Commission’. They attempted to orchestrate VIP movements with police escorts for Saini’s Odisha visit. Their detailed itinerary and claims raised suspicions, leading to their airport arrest.
